I haven't been on this board in a while but I occasionally like to check in and see how everyone is doing. I recently got away from following the rules and have an additional 10 lbs. to show for it, so I am now back to drinking my protein shakes and making the appropriate food choices like protein first. I am finding that I really have to work at maintaining at this stage being 2 1/2 years out. I am back at exercising at least 3 times a week. (Before I was in the gym at least 4 days a week sometimes 6) I wish that there was more activity on this board, I really believe that we could motivate each other since most of us are probably tackling the same mental and physical challenges. Hope to hear from some of you too. Saundra

Hi Saundra It's good to see you posting. I so understand your struggles. I think before wls we should all be required to go into extensive counseling and understand just how hard it is to not gain after two years out. I mean, the first year or so we lose so easily and we expect it to keep going. It doesn't happen like that. I mean yeah when we were early out and seen people posting how they were gaining and stuff we just thought they was eating candy and things like that. But let me tell you, i can gain just eating the right way if i don't exercise like i should. But i am determined to stay fit the rest of my life, no matter what! So i'm proud of you for taking this under control. Hope to see you posting more. Hugs Linda
